NOTD: Essie Lady Like

Haven't wrote in a long time, I've been attempting to get back on my routine of school, yay (sarcastically) and hope you had a good summer! Anyways, today I am wearing a polish called Lady Like by Essie. I was in the mood to wear a somewhat simple polish instead of a crazy hot pink or bright neon green. Fun fact, this was my first ever polish since I haven't got into nail polish until last year. I would consider this polish a somewhat neutral color with a hint of purple.



                                                                                                  This is a tan-ish purple polish. The formulation is pretty good, but may be a bit streaky now and then. I would have to say this polish is somewhat opaque, but opaque enough for just two decent layers. It has a somewhat shiny finish and of course it would look nice with a shiny top coat. 
(two coats)

You can purchase this product at any drugstore for around $6-$8.

NOTD: OPIs You Callin' Me A Lyre?

Today's nail polish is probably one of my favorite nail polishes by OPI because it's a very pretty sheer pink. This polish is in the New York City Ballet collection with other pretty sheer polishes as well. I feel like it can match basically anything because it's so neutral and simple. This color looks perfect for a french manicure or even just alone.



     OPI's You Callin' Me A Lyre?
←            ↑            →
 (2 coats, without top coat)

I am absolutely in love with this color because it's sheer it helps your nails still look natural, but I feel that it just enhances your nails and make them look 100x better than before. As shown in the picture, the polish gives off a glossy/shiny finish which is good especially since my nails were top coat-less (because I had run out my top coat). So now I know that if I add a top coat it will add a beautiful shine to the nails. Also, I am especially in love with the name of the polish and how they put a tiny pun into the name.

This nail polish is sold at any drugstore that sells OPI nail polish and it retails for around $8-9.
